The place of Juan García is inside the municipality of José Azueta (in the State of Veracruz de Ignacio de la Llave). There are 563 inhabitants. In the list of the most populated towns of the whole municipality, it is the number #11 of the ranking. Juan García is at 9 meters of altitude.

Data: In Juan García, 37% of the inhabitants are catholic and 80% of the dwellings are equipped with a washing machine. At the bottom of this page you will find more information.

Do you want to locate the town of Juan García? You can find it at 23.1 kilometers, in direction South, from the town of Villa Azueta, which has the largest population within the municipality.
